About this listen
'We'll play the game of make believe....'
Jenny Collins was once a beautiful singer, married into a rich family. Now she lives locked in a tower at Collinwood. Her husband has left her, her children have been taken away, and the horror and isolation have driven her mad. The only person she ever sees is Beth, the maid who brings her food.
Together they play a game - re-creating the past, reliving everything that poor mad Jenny lost. They've played the game before...but tonight something's different. Tonight something's got into the game....
